What is SPARC? 

SPARC serves children and adolescents with an autism spectrum disorder. Our mission is to offer empirically validated behavioral treatment programs to aid families in their journey through the developmental disabilities maze, so that both children and families receive state of the art therapeutic services that will help them in all facets of their lives. We strive to offer comprehensive services that will facilitate academic, social, and personal growth. 

The Center provides both Center- and community-based diagnostic, therapeutic, and educational services to clients. The Center will also provide educational and consultative services to community organizations such as parent groups, schools and other service agencies.
